One major advantage for the
residents of this city is that there is a choice of location. While
Whitefield, Sarjapur Road, and Hebbal were the first target locations for
developers, Kanakapura Road is among the latest in the offing. For
Bangaloreans, Kanakapura Road, till a few years ago, meant the Roerich's
Tataguni Estate, dhabas for the evening out with friends, and perhaps even
the Tamarind Tree popular for music concerts. Cut to the present. The scene has
transformed into one of the most sought-after areas that is busy with
activities. Kanakapura Road Bangalore has everything to offer on a
platter for a resident here.
Many factors have direct to
growth here. Residential layouts and availability of land is one. Shopping
centers and commercial activities came up with the residential
development. This belt is known for its cultural and spiritual touch. The road
projects have made it well-connected to the rest of the city.
The Public Works Department has
a new project planned that will connect Kanakapura Road, Bannerghatta Road,
Jigani Industrial Road, Anekal and Attibele. This circuit is planned
to create a 'corridor' for industrial development. Towards Mysore, the
Bangalore-Mysore Infrastructure Corridor project cuts across Kanakapura
Road.
